About the author

Michael Carpenter is a 35-year veteran of the investment business and founder of his consulting firm CarpenterAssociates.

Since entering the investment business as a financial advisor with PaineWebber prior to the OPEC Oil Embargo of 1973 he has personally advised investors, financial professionals and investment firms facing turbulent investment environments, including raging inflation,stagflation, and stratospheric interest rates to disinflation, recessions, panics, and crashes."
